Growth & profitability

  • Revenue has declined 22.7% per year over the past 4 years.

Financial health

  • Total debt ($22M) exceeds cash ($7M); net debt is $15M.
  • Total debt has grown faster than revenue (-6.0% vs -22.7% per year).
  • Operating income covered interest expense -2.7× in the latest year.

Frequently asked questions

Is KITT growing its revenue and profit?

Over the past 4 years, Nauticus Robotics, Inc.'s revenue has declined 22.7% per year. These are computed facts, not advice.

How much debt does KITT have?

As of FY2025, Nauticus Robotics, Inc. reported $22M of total debt against $7M of cash; operating income covered interest expense -2.7×.

What is KITT's profit margin?

In FY2025, gross margin was —, operating margin -449.8%, and net margin -774.0%.
